Anisotropy of the microwave background radiation
Abstract
New results of data reduction of the Relict-1 space experiment investigating the anisotropy of the cosmic microwave background at 37 GHz are presented. For the inflation spectrum of primordial perturbations, estimates in the range of 6 x 10 exp -6 to 3.3 x 10 exp -5 Delta-T2/T are obtained for the relative magnitude of the quadrupole component. A radio-emission anomaly was detected with a 99-percent confidence coefficient in a region with an area of about 1 sterad.
